Ray,
First make sure that your AP ip/dns name is configured in your list of
RADIUS clients in IAS.
To do a MAC address authentication, you will need to user the
CallingStationID condition in IAS.
http://www.microsoft.com/technet/prodtechnol/windowsserver2003/library/TechRef/e9a30a60-7f8b-435f-b210-d47c3b7ecb96.mspx
has some details on this.
If it still does not work, look at the event log to see what IAS says. You
can copy those events and someone can tell you what may be wrong.
